Peterbilt named Stahl Peterbilt in Canada its 2007 Dealer of the Year and Hunter Peterbilt in Smithfield (Uniontown) Pennsylvania its 2007 Medium Duty Truck Dealer of the Year.
Ed, Paige and Eddy Stahl, Dealer Principals of Stahl Peterbilt in Canada, and Bob Hunter, Dealer Principal of Hunter Peterbilt, were honored during Peterbilt's annual dealer meeting.
The Stahls, who own three Peterbilt dealerships in Edmonton, Grande Prairie, and Fort McMurray in Alberta, Canada received the award for their Edmonton location. Since joining the Peterbilt dealer network in 2003, the Stahls have consistently provided excellent customer service that has resulted in year-over-year increased sales. Their philosophy of meeting and exceeding customer expectations has fueled the dealership's success.
The Stahl's Edmonton facility is one of the premier truck dealerships in North America. In 2005, they relocated to a new 75,000-square-foot building, which includes an indoor truck display large enough for two trucks, 2,200 square feet of parts retail display area, 25 service bays and an 8-bay body shop.
Hunter Peterbilt was selected as the medium-duty winner based on their consistent support of the Peterbilt Medium Duty product throughout the year, resulting in increased sales volume and market share for Peterbilt. The Hunters' exceptional marketing efforts, strong customer relationships, and utilization of the St. Therese, Canada manufacturing facility all contributed to their selection as this year's Peterbilt Medium Duty Dealer of the Year.
The Hunter family has owned and operated Hunter Peterbilt since 1984. They have 12 locations in Pennsylvania, New Jersey, and New York.
